Global Business

Global Business refers to commercial activities that involve the trading of goods, services, or economic transactions across international borders. It encompasses a wide range of business operations that can include exporting, importing, multinational enterprises, and global supply chains. Companies engaged in global business often adapt their products and strategies to different markets, considering cultural, legal, and economic differences. The term reflects the interconnectedness of economies and markets, and it highlights the necessity for businesses to operate in a global context to achieve growth and competitiveness. Global business is influenced by factors such as international trade agreements, technological advancements, and global market trends, making it a dynamic aspect of modern commerce.
